F1: Giovinazzi continues with Ferrari
Ferrari has renewed its multi-year contract with Antonio Giovinazzi, who will continue to represent the Prancing Horse as official driver in WEC and reserve driver for the F1 team. The collaboration between the Italian and the Maranello outfit, which has seen him distinguish himself in races and wins of particular significance, including the Centenary 24 Hours of Le Mans win in June 2023, when Ferrari - on its return to the top class of endurance racing after half a century - won the fourth round of the FIA WEC with the 499P number 51 entrusted to Giovinazzi, Alessandro Pier Guidi and James Calado.
